1 Cloning of the pig long form leptin receptor (OB-Rb) targeted gene and development of the riboprobeAccording to the pig gene sequence published on Genebank, a pair of primers were designed and synthesized. Total RNA was isolated from the thypothalamus of a Landrace pig by Trizole method. 343 bp cDNA fragment was generated by re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R) and cloned into pGEM-T Easy Vector. The recombinant plasmid was identified by several kinds of specific methods and comfirmed that the cDNA fragment sequence is full consistent with the published pig OB-Rb gene sequence on Genebank. After the recombinant plasmid was linearized by Apa I and Sac I endonucleases, the antisense and sense riboprobes to the long form leptin receptor were generated by in vitro transcription. The dot blot method was used to estimate the concentration of the riboprobes, and the detection result showed that the concentration of the riboprobes were 100 ng/ul, meeting the requirement of the hybridization.2 Localization of OB-Rb mRNA in the hypothalamus in the pig studied by in situ hybridizationLocalization of OB-Rb mRNA in hypothalamus in 5 female Landrace pigs (2 to 3 months old) were investigated by in situ hybridization. OB-Rb mRNA was located in the arcute nucleus, ventromedial nucleus, dorsomedial nucleus, paraventricular nucleus, periventricular nucleus and lateral region of the hypothalamus in the pig.3 Localization of OB-Rb mRNA in the cerebral cortex, hippocampal formation, piriform lobe and amygdala in the pig studied by in situ hybridizationLocalization of OB-Rb mRNA in the cerebral cortex, hippocampal formation,piriform lobe and amygdala in 10 Landrace pigs (2 to 3 months bid) were studied by in situ hybridization. In the cerebral cortex and piriform lobe, OB-Rb mRNA were observed primarily in the II-VI layers and with a few in the I layer, Within the hippocampal formation, OB-Rb mRNA was found mainly in the stratum pyramidale of the hippocampus and the stratum granulosum of the dentate gyrus, with the minority in the stratum oriens of the hippocampus and the polymorphic layer of the dentate gyrus, and with a few in the stratum radiatum and stratum lacunosum of the hippocampus. In the amygdala, OB-Rb mRNA was found mainly in the corticomedial nucleus and with the minority in the basolateral nucleus and central nucleus.4 Localization of OB-Rb mRNA in the thalamus, cerebellum and medulla oblongata in the pig studied by in situ hybridizationLocalization of OB-Rb mRNA in thalamus, cerebellum and medulla oblongata in Landrace pigs (n = 5)(2to3 months old ) were studied by in situ hybridization. The results showed that OB-Rb mRNA was located in the thalamus, cerebellum and medulla oblongata in Landrace pigs. In the thalamus, OB-Rb mRNA were observed almost in all nuclei with most in the midline nuclear group, thalamic parayentricular nucleus and anterior nuclear group. Within the cerebellum, OB-Rb mRNA were found in all three layers, with the majority in the Purkinjie cell and granular layers. In the medulla oblongata, OB-Rb mRNA were observed in the inferior olivary nucleus, the nucleus of the solitary tract, dorsal motor nucleus of the vagus nerve and the hypoglossal nucleus.Our results were similar to those obtained in human, rodents and sheep, confirmed previous studied in other animals and enriched the data of OB-Rb mRNA gene expression in the brain. Our research work provided anatomic information tb understand the physiology and functional mechanism of leptin, and laid a foundation for a further study on co-localization of OB-Rb mRNA with others neuropeptides in the brain. |
